To start with, the cost of a metal garage is determined by several variables, beginning with size and scale. Standard metal garages typically range from $5,000 to $20,000. This wide range is largely influenced by dimensions; a larger structure entails more materials and labor, thus increasing costs. For example, a single-car garage measuring approximately 12x20 feet may cost around $6,000, while a larger, two- or three-car garage spans from 20x40 feet and can climb upwards of $15,000. Next, geographic location plays a critical role in the pricing structure due to logistics and local building codes. Areas with higher transportation costs or stringent regulations may see an increase in pricing. It's crucial to check local mandates concerning construction permits and fees, which could add several hundred dollars to your final bill.

Material quality is another pivotal component affecting cost. Metal garages are typically constructed from steel, renowned for its durability and strength. Opting for galvanized steel, which offers enhanced resistance to corrosion and harsh weather, could incur additional costs but also promises longevity. Powder-coated finishes further influence the price by adding a protective layer that is both aesthetically pleasing and functional, especially in harsh climates. Design customization often necessitates additional investment. While basic models come with standard features, customizing your garage with features such as additional windows, doors, insulation, or aesthetic detailing increases the cost. High-end customization like integrated storage solutions or custom paint work comes at a premium, emphasizing the value of personalizing your space to fit specific needs and preferences. The construction and installation process itself represents another expense. While some DIY enthusiasts choose to erect their own metal garages to save money, hiring professional installation services ensures quality workmanship and adherence to safety standards, though it bumps up the cost. Installing a metal garage typically ranges from $2,000 to $5,000, depending on the complexity of the design and scope of work. Professionals bring expertise and experience, minimizing the risks of costly mistakes—a necessary consideration for those lacking the skills or time for a self-installation project.cost for metal garage
Maintenance, often overlooked during initial budgeting, is a long-term cost that should be factored in. Metal garages demand regular upkeep to preserve structural integrity and visual appeal, particularly if exposed to erratic weather conditions. Routine inspections, cleaning, and minor repairs help prevent larger, more costly fixes down the line. Return on investment should also be considered when assessing costs. Metal garages, due to their durability and low maintenance, can add significant value to your property. Potential buyers often view them as a desirable asset, capable of boosting resale value. As such, although upfront costs can seem daunting, they often translate into financial gains over time, particularly if you maintain the structure well and customize it to meet prospective buyers’ expectations. Financing solutions are available for those concerned about upfront expenses. Many providers offer payment plans or financing arrangements to alleviate immediate financial pressure. This option can make an otherwise costly project more accessible, but it is essential to scrutinize the terms of any financial agreement to ensure it aligns with your financial strategy.
